Comprehending Railroad Settlement Claims
Railroad settlement claims refer to the payment sought by people hurt in mishaps involving trains. These claims can develop from numerous incidents, such as crashes, derailments, or negligent actions by railroad business. The Federal Employers Liability Act (FELA) governs much of these claims, as it supplies a framework for Railroad Settlement cll employees looking for settlement for on-the-job injuries.

FELA Claims
Unlike employees' settlement, FELA allows railroad employees to sue their employers for carelessness. Workers can recover damages for medical bills, lost incomes, and discomfort and suffering.

The length of time do I need to submit a Railroad Settlement All settlement claim?
The statute of constraints for FELA claims is typically three years from the date of the injury, while state laws might differ for individual injury and wrongful death claims.
2. Can I sue if I was partly at fault?
Yes, under FELA, you may still recuperate damages even if you were partially at fault for the mishap. This principle is various from traditional workers' settlement laws.
3. Are railroad business liable for mishaps including trespassers?
Railroad companies may have restricted liability for mishaps including intruders, but they are still required to preserve safe environments and might deal with liability if neglect can be shown.
